Parents Welcome reception

Master, Lara McKay and Vice-Master, Dr Ari Metuamate welcomed over 250 parents of current students to Ormond College for this reception on Friday 17 March in the Quad. 

The Melbourne weather was more than kind as parents of new and returning students gathered to meet each other as well as the Master and the Vice-Master.

Lara thanked parents for travelling from all over Australia to be present on the evening, a sign of their dedication to their children’s education, careers and futures.

Ari welcomed parents and introduced Dean of Student Success, Rose Jost as well as Dean of Student Life, James Kelly, all of whom live on campus and are in frequent contact with the students on a day-to-day basis.

Prior to the gathering at Ormond, the OCA, lead by Simon Thornton (1988) and Hugh Macdonald (1986) arranged for alumni parents to gather with their Ormond children at Naughton’s for an informal get together before heading over to Ormond for the reception.
